wordpress首页分类目录静态
时间 : 2023-12-25 15:53:03 声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性

最佳答案

要将WordPress首页的分类目录设置为静态,您需要进行以下步骤:

1. 登录到您的WordPress后台管理面板。

2. 在侧边栏中,找到并点击“设置”选项卡。

3. 在下拉菜单中选择“常规”选项。

4. 在常规设置页面的“站点地址(URL)”字段旁边,找到“永久链接结构”部分。点击“自定义结构”选项。

5. 在自定义结构的文本框中,输入以下代码:%category%/%postname%/

这将在您的URL中包含分类目录和文章的名称。例如,如果您的分类目录为“blog”,并且您发布了一篇名为“Hello World”的文章,则该文章的URL将是:www.example.com/blog/hello-world/。

6. 点击“保存更改”按钮以保存设置。

7. 现在您的WordPress首页的分类目录链接将在URL中显示并引导访问者到对应的分类目录页面。

请注意,设置静态URL结构可能需要更改您的网站的.htaccess文件权限。如果您在设置过程中遇到任何问题,请务必备份您的.htaccess文件,并在设置完成后重新设置权限。

希望以上步骤对您有所帮助!如果您有任何疑问,请随时向我提问。

其他答案

在WordPress中,分类目录是用于组织和分类文章的一种方式。一般情况下,WordPress的文章列表页默认是动态生成的,即每次打开页面时都会重新获取和显示相应的文章信息。然而,有些用户希望将分类目录页变成静态页面,以便提高页面加载速度和搜索引擎优化。

要将WordPress的分类目录页变成静态页面,可以采取以下步骤:

步骤1:创建一个分类目录模板文件

首先,我们需要创建一个自定义的模板文件来显示分类目录页面。可以在主题目录下创建一个新的文件,命名为category.php(如果已存在,则可以跳过此步骤)。

步骤2:编辑分类目录模板文件

打开category.php文件,在文件中添加以下代码:

```php

<?php /* Template Name: Category Page */ ?>

<?php get_header(); ?>

<div id="primary" class="content-area">

<main id="main" class="site-main">

<?php if ( have_posts() ) : ?>

<header class="page-header">

<h1 class="page-title">

<?php single_cat_title(); ?>

</h1>

</header>

<?php while ( have_posts() ) : the_post(); ?>

<article id="post-<?php the_ID(); ?>" <?php post_class(); ?>>

<header class="entry-header">

<h2 class="entry-title">

<a href="<?php the_permalink(); ?>" rel="bookmark">

<?php the_title(); ?>

</a>

</h2>

</header>

<div class="entry-content">

<?php the_excerpt(); ?>

</div>

</article>

<?php endwhile; ?>

<?php endif; ?>

</main>

</div>

<?php get_footer(); ?>

基本上,这段代码会显示分类目录的标题以及所属文章列表。你可以根据自己的需要来自定义页面的其他部分。

步骤3:创建静态页面

在WordPress的后台管理界面中,转到“页面”->“添加新页面”。在页面标题栏中输入分类目录的名称,并在模板下拉菜单中选择“Category Page”(即刚才创建的自定义模板)。

步骤4:设置静态页面为首页

在WordPress的后台管理界面中,转到“设置”->“阅读”。在“前端页面显示”部分,将首页设置为刚才创建的分类目录静态页面,并保存更改。

完成以上步骤后,WordPress的首页就会显示为静态生成的分类目录页了。这样可以提高页面加载速度,并且有助于搜索引擎优化。记得每次更新和修改文章时,都要重新生成静态页面,以确保内容的及时更新。